    I have a salty fluval edge, i've had it for idk 2 years now? My mother works at hagen so i get stuff right at release/alittle before and honestly its a GREAT TANK but if i had to do it over again, i wouldnt have gone salty on it. Unless your building a custom led fixture to fit right under the hood, or buy the nanocustoms fluval fixture, its alot of hassle. I tried the mr-11's and got crappy growth and all my zoas went brown, then i modded the hood to stuff two 50/50 bulbs in there and THEN i added another suplimental pc over the glass but i hated the look and finally i just bought a nanocustoms par38 bulb and i'm hanging that over the tank as i've seen many people do the same because its honestly the easiest way to light it without spending alot or going DIY.

    Yeah, I'd go with a PAR30 from boost, just a nicer color. One "robot led" bulb ain't gonna cut it for SPS. Filtration wise it is like a biocube, small chamber in the back. You could probably get away with some Chaeto in there and some carbon. You could even do some other chemical media or mangrove shoots. Flow wise I would get a tiny PicoEvo or something, or split the locline return. But besides that, you should be good. Check that vid, he has SPS under the PAR30. Ask Matt Rogers, he owns one.
